W3C

- DRAFT -

ARIA APG TF

26 Nov 2018

Attendees

Present
jamesn, jemma, MarkMcCarthy, AnnAbbott, evan, jongund, BryanGaraventa, matt_king, CurtBellew, siri_
Regrets
Chair
MattKing
Scribe
AnnAbbott

Contents


<jamesn> reagent, make log world

<jemma> https://github.com/w3c/aria-practices/wiki/November-26%2C-2018-Meeting

<evan> +present

scribe, AnnAbbott

aria-at (canIUse) project

mck: will set up web site and send invitations to this group

Branch management

mck: reviewing what is in agenda for this topic
... documentation will go into wiki

Release 3 pull request discussion

PR 887

<mck> pr 887: https://github.com/w3c/aria-practices/pull/887

<jongund> https://rawgit.com/jongund/aria-practices/toolbar/examples/toolbar/toolbar.html

jn: will push discussion to issue if needed

mck: failing checks and should have stubs for regression test cases
... toolbar contains a bunch of different widgets so eventually want to test them
... document arrow key nav, home/end

<jemma> https://github.com/w3c/aria-practices/pull/887/checks?check_run_id=31914800

<jongund> https://rawgit.com/jongund/aria-practices/toolbar/examples/toolbar/toolbar.html

mck: opinion(s) from group regarding documenting all widgets

Evan: document what is specific to example

specific to pattern, not example

aa: agrees - document specific to pattern
... list others as auxillary or?

jn: include links to other patterns

jg: using widgets in ways not documented already - some widgets are unique

mck: generally don't need to repeat other patterns
... don't want to distract with contents of toolbar container
... radio and menus are special

jg: when in pop-up, arrow moves to next menubar

mck: arrow nav should be standard

bg: arrow should do nothing

mck: radios are different and should be explained

jg: references should point to design pattern or example?

mck

mck: point to examples
... still need spinner example without value
... if use native html so no need to point to examples
... document why using aria-disabled

<jemma> https://www.w3.org/TR/wai-aria-practices-1.2/#kbd_disabled_controls

jg: leave kbd stuff in there because dev has trouble understanding it

aa: agree with jg
... complex enough to leave all documentation

Mark; agrees

Evan: add links too

<jemma> https://www.w3.org/TR/wai-aria-practices-1.2/#toolbar

mck: could add sentence that indicates widgets included

<jemma> A toolbar is a container for grouping a set of controls, such as buttons, menubuttons, or checkboxes.

mck: advantage of leaving tables is for test also

mck; what about roles, states & properties?

jg: index page uses these tables
... tables list only what roles, states & properties are used in this example

<jemma> https://github.com/w3c/aria-practices/pull/887/checks?check_run_id=31914800

<evan> failing tests start on line 697: https://travis-ci.com/w3c/aria-practices/jobs/158664422#L697

mck: linting errors and regression test error
... needed before merge into master

Evan: can write test for first one

<jemma> https://github.com/w3c/aria-practices/tree/master/test/tests

<jemma> https://github.com/w3c/aria-practices/blob/master/test/tests/toolbar.js

mck: already toolbar test, so modify it

Evan: tables need test IDs
... can help if questions

mck: model after menubar

PR 945: carousel : https://github.com/w3c/aria-practices/pull/945

jg: PR 947 not needed

correction: jg: PR 927 not needed

Future meetings and other business

No meetings on December 24 and December 31

rssagent, make minutes

Summary of Action Items

Summary of Resolutions

[End of minutes]

Minutes manually created (not a transcript), formatted by David Booth's scribe.perl version 1.154 (CVS log)
$Date: 2018/11/26 19:00:27 $

Scribe.perl diagnostic output

[Delete this section before finalizing the minutes.]
This is scribe.perl Revision: 1.154  of Date: 2018/09/25 16:35:56  
Check for newer version at http://dev.w3.org/cvsweb/~checkout~/2002/scribe/

Guessing input format: Irssi_ISO8601_Log_Text_Format (score 1.00)

Present: jamesn jemma MarkMcCarthy AnnAbbott evan jongund BryanGaraventa matt_king CurtBellew siri_
No ScribeNick specified.  Guessing ScribeNick: AnnAbbott
Inferring Scribes: AnnAbbott

WARNING: No date found!  Assuming today.  (Hint: Specify
the W3C IRC log URL, and the date will be determined from that.)
Or specify the date like this:
<dbooth> Date: 12 Sep 2002

People with action items: 

WARNING: Input appears to use implicit continuation lines.
You may need the "-implicitContinuations" option.


WARNING: IRC log location not specified!  (You can ignore this 
warning if you do not want the generated minutes to contain 
a link to the original IRC log.)


[End of scribe.perl diagnostic output]